Recorded direct to disk for the excellent Netherlands based Night Dreamer label, this project sees the long-awaited return of saxophonist and flute player Finn Peters. After a lengthy sabbatical Finn has moved to Amsterdam and it’s there he leads the six-piece Stargazers band through some of his compositions.
Drawing on the spiritual, freedom-driven sound of 60s/70s Black jazz, Stargazers breathes new life into Finn’s introspective, quietly crafted and previously hidden musical diary. Alongside rhythm section siblings Yoran and Yariv Vroom, bassist Jeroen Vierdag, Timothy Blanchet on keys and Gideon Tazelaar’s tenor sax, Peters delivers a new record that represents both his range of influences, the kinetic interplay of his consummate improvisors and the versatility of his own playing on alto sax, flute and Moog.
A highlight is a piece called “Clifford Jordan”, which builds on the iconic tenor players own classic 70s Strata East dedication to John Coltrane.
